Most important, we have probably increased our frequency of engagement with all friends -- close and not-so-close -- on a daily basis, and no doubt by a dramatic margin. Facebook gives people a great way to engage in social interactions at low social cost, so to speak. There's minimal risk of non-reciprocation, the way there could be with SMS or email or phone calls. Thus, the barriers to initiating social contact are drastically lowered. Frequency increases accordingly.
